I will give you the vehicle history and describe it to the best of my ability, leaving nothing out. 1. My uncle bought this vehicle on 07-07-75. He lived in Mesquite, TX (a suburb of Dallas). 2. My uncle used the car as a daily driver until 1982. In 1982 he permanently parked it in the the garage. 3. From the time he purchased it in '75 until '82 he parked it in the garage at night. Since 1982 it has not left his garage, until last month. 4. I have not seen any rust on the car, and do not believe it has any rust issues (other than maybe the brakes). 5. I have no idea why he did not drive it anymore after 1982. 6. My uncle passed away last month and left this car to me in his will. 7. A few weeks ago we had it hauled from his home in Mesquite, TX to my parents home in McAlester, Oklahoma; where the car presently sits under a tarp in their fenced in backyard. 8. The car does not have a battery in it, but I hooked up the jumper cables to it just to see if it would crank. The engine cranked fine, but obviously it would not start (one would probably need to replace the gasoline, water, plugs, points, and plugs). 9. The car has a V-8, 289 engine (that is all I know about it). 10. It is an automatic. 11. The right front wheel would not roll when we were winching it up on the trailer, and when we were getting it off of the trailer. The right front wheel is locked up for some reason. 12. They said the plate had been painted over, but the information appears to be as follows: Body 76A 5D6 28T 62 6 Vehicle 5S08C-773820 Ford If this doesn't fit or is wrong, please let me know and I will ask my Dad to put some paint remover on the door jamb plate, and try reading it again. 17. Three hubcaps are on the car. Three tires are flat. There are some various emblems and misc. parts in the glove compartment and trunk. 18. The interior is dirty due to years of being parked in a dusty garage, but may clean-up fairly well with some good chemical cleaner. As the photos show there are a few upholstery seams coming apart here & there. In other words, the interior upholstery may or may not be salvageable. 19. The mileage I have stated in this description is based on the odometer reading only. I have no idea how many miles are on the car. 20. The body appears to be very straight, with one small body ding/kink being located near the driver's side headlight. 21.
